2. Key Details at a Glance
| Particular | Information |
|---|---|
| Exam | Himachal Pradesh Teacher Eligibility Test (HP TET) |
| Conducting Authority | Himachal Pradesh Board of School Education |
| Session | November 2025 |
| Exam Dates | 02 to 16 November 2025 |
| Result Declaration | 02 January 2026 |
| Scorecard Access | hpbose.org (Roll No./Application No.) |
| Certificate Validity | Lifetime |
| Next Stage | Eligibility to apply for teaching recruitments |
No interview, no mains exam, and no document verification is conducted by HPBOSE for TET itself.
3. Understanding the Result (Beyond “Qualified / Not Qualified”)
🔹 What the Cut-off Actually Indicates
- General category candidates need 90/150 (60%)
- SC/ST/OBC/PwD candidates need around 82-83/150 (55%)
This cut-off is fixed, not relative. That means you are not competing against other candidates-you are competing against a benchmark.
So if you scored 89 marks (General category), even missing by 1 mark, the result is still Not Qualified. Painful, yes-but that clarity is important.
🔹 How to Interpret Your Score
- 90-110 range: You’ve met eligibility, but future selection will depend heavily on your performance in recruitment exams.
- 110+ range: Strong conceptual base. You are better placed for competitive teacher recruitments.
- Below cut-off: This is a signal-not of failure-but of gaps that must be fixed before the next attempt.

6. Cut-Off Analysis & Competition Insight
HP TET cut-offs have remained stable over the years because:
- It is a qualifying exam, not a ranking exam
- Question level is moderate, syllabus-based
However:
- The number of candidates is increasing
- Recruitment exams after TET are becoming tougher
👉 This means: Qualifying TET is becoming easier than getting selected for a job.
Future aspirants should focus not just on “passing TET” but on building exam-ready teaching aptitude.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1. Will I get a job automatically after qualifying HP TET? No. HP TET only makes you eligible to apply for teaching jobs.
Q2. When will the HP TET certificate be issued? The exact date is not available yet. Keep checking hpbose.org regularly.
Q3. Is HP TET certificate valid outside Himachal Pradesh? Generally, it is mainly applicable for HP recruitments. Acceptance elsewhere depends on the recruiting authority.
Q4. Can I improve my score after qualifying? You can reappear in future TET exams if you want a higher score, but it’s not mandatory once qualified.
